Bandits attack Niger State communities again, shattering the fragile calm in the North Central region after armed assailants carried out coordinated and violent raids that left residents traumatized. The attacks, which occurred in the early hours of the week, targeted communities within the Borgu Local Government Area and nearby settlements, resulting in multiple deaths, destruction of property, and the abduction of villagers. Among those killed was an 85 year old woman who could not escape when the attackers overran her home, underscoring the ruthless nature of the assault.

Eyewitness accounts revealed that the attackers arrived in large numbers on motorcycles, heavily armed and operating with precision. They moved from one area to another, opening fire indiscriminately and setting shops and food stores ablaze. Several businesses were reduced to ashes, wiping out sources of income and food supplies that many families depend on for survival. At least four people were confirmed dead in one of the affected communities, while others sustained serious gunshot injuries as they fled into nearby bushes in an attempt to save their lives.

Beyond the killings and destruction, the attackers also carried out abductions that have deepened the community’s suffering. According to local leaders, several villagers were seized during the raids and taken into forested areas that stretch across the state’s borders. The abducted victims reportedly include women and children, and no contact has yet been made with their families. The silence from the kidnappers has fueled anxiety and fear, as relatives remain uncertain about the fate of their loved ones.

The attack reflects a disturbing pattern of violence that has become common in parts of Niger State, where armed groups increasingly target rural communities for both terror and financial gain. Kidnapping for ransom has continued to cripple agrarian settlements, forcing families into debt and displacement while creating an atmosphere of constant fear.

Security operatives have since been deployed to the affected areas to restore calm and pursue the attackers. However, residents expressed frustration over what they described as slow intervention despite prior warnings about suspicious movements near surrounding forests. Community members, including local hunters and vigilantes, have intensified self defense efforts as calls grow louder for stronger federal support. The Niger State government has appealed for enhanced security operations, including aerial surveillance, to dismantle bandit camps and prevent further bloodshed.

For the people of Borgu and neighboring communities, the immediate priority remains the safe rescue of those abducted and the hope that decisive action will finally bring relief to areas that have suffered repeated attacks.
